#988564 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#988564 is composed of 59.6% red, 52.2%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.5% magenta, 34.2%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 38.1 degrees, a saturation of 20.6% and a lightness of 49.4%. #988564 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c8 with #310b00.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

#988564 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#988564 has RGB values of R:152, G:133,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.34,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 9995620.
